Binotto denies Ferrari to test new parts on Wednesday

Aug.4 Mattia Binotto has denied that Ferrari will use a 'filming day' at Silverstone on Wednesday to try urgent car updates. While the other teams wait onsite for the second installation of the Silverstone double-header, it emerges that Ferrari will be in action mid-week. When asked if Ferrari is using the opportunity to try urgent updates amid its competitive crisis, team boss Binotto answered: "It is for our commercial needs. "They are very limited and dedicated kilometres for filming. For the next grand prix, we are working back at home and also in the simulator," he added.
